Description
English: Hercules Farnese, scale-down copy of the antique original. Marble, date unspecified.
Français : Hercule Farnèse, réduction d'après l'antique par Henri-Charles Maniglier (Français, 1826-1901). Marbre, date non mentionnée. Ancienne collection d'Adolphe Thiers.
